Report Method
The ALPHA Touch can print to the internal printer or Vitalograph Reports. The
following options are available:
• Report: Select either ‘Send to PC’ or ‘Internal Printer’ from the drop
down list.
• Content: Select ‘Default report’ or the ‘Congurable report’ option
from the drop down list.
• Colour: The printout can be set to Colour or Black & White. Select on
for a colour printout (print via a PC) and off for black & white.
Note: In order to send the report to the Vitalograph Reports utility it is necessary
to have the Vitalograph Reports Utility installed on the user’s PC and the ALPHA
Touch connected to the PC via a USB cable.
